On 6/16/2008 , the vessel BANKER II (Official Number 396180) was involved in a grounding - under power (non-intentional) in HECATE STRAIT, BC, BRITISH COLUMBIA (BC).
The vessel, with 4 persons on board, experienced the incident while engaged in regular operations. Fortunately, the ship was able to continue its voyage. No injuries or fatalities were reported, and there was none pollution.
This incident was officially recorded by Transport Canada on 6/23/2008 . Weather at the time was reported as clear with winds from the SE at 5.00 knots.
On 16 June 2008, the fishing vessel "BANKER II" ran aground while enroute in Hecate Strait, B.C.
